Abstract

The invention relates to a multipurpose remote mouse key control method and a system, the method converts absolute coordinates of a mouse and a touch pad of a local control end and touch points of a touch screen into mouse events of relative coordinate positions through a normalization conversion algorithm, then packages messages through a standard UDP network protocol and sends the messages to a remote controlled end, and the remote control is carried out after analysis and processing.

Background
If interfaces of a plurality of control consoles need to be projected to a remote end display screen for display, a mouse and a keyboard of the remote end need to be controlled, if the interfaces of the remote controlled end are projected to a local control end by means of a tool such as a VNC, the requirement on network bandwidth is high, and the situation that the interfaces are blocked when being sent to a local desktop often occurs. If the mouse and keyboard events of the local control end are projected to the remote controlled end through the network, the occupied bandwidth is very small, and the requirement of narrow bandwidth can be met.
The local control end can be a small Pad or a touch Pad, which is different from a traditional mouse pointer, and a user interacts with touch equipment through gestures, so that the operation experience of the user is improved.
As computers continue to evolve, it has become common for individuals to own multiple computers, and computer remote, autonomous services (users accessing computers in different places at home, at companies, during business trips) have become an increasingly urgent need. In daily work, a user can eliminate problems for a client in a remote control mode, so that the problems of regions and time can be solved.
The control console is controlled to have small space and overall attractive effect, a mouse and a keyboard are not accessed from the outside, and mouse and keyboard events need to be virtualized. The mouse and keyboard of the local control end are used for controlling the mouse key of the remote control end, and the following problems are caused:
the local control end is provided with a touch pad, a touch screen and a mouse, wherein absolute coordinates of touch points of the touch pad and the touch screen cannot be directly sent to the remote controlled end and need to be converted into relative coordinates which can be received by a mouse pointer of the remote controlled end.
When a user remotely controls, the local mouse and the local keyboard do not influence the files and programs of the interface; when the user quits the remote control, the local mouse and the local keyboard can be controlled, the remote desktop is not controlled, and the files and the programs of the interface of the remote controlled end are not influenced.

Detailed Description
The present invention will be described in further detail with reference to the accompanying drawings, and provides a multipurpose remote mouse control method, which includes the following steps, as shown in fig. 1:
s1, the local control end and the remote controlled end respectively initialize the corresponding networks;
the local control end and the remote controlled end are kylin 4.0 operating systems, and initializing the network comprises initializing a network Socket and a port number.
Events of the mouse and the keyboard are initialized, and mouse events 0, touchpad events 1, touch screen events 2 and keyboard events 3 are read through a read function.
S2, initializing an information data structure by the local control end and the remote controlled end respectively, wherein the information data structure comprises an ID number of a message, relative coordinate information of a mouse, absolute coordinate information of a touch pad and a touch screen and key information of a keyboard;
s3, the local control terminal converts the commands of the touch pad and the touch screen into mouse events at relative coordinate positions through a normalization algorithm by identifying user operation, packages the mouse events and key information of the keyboard into messages and sends the messages to the remote controlled terminal; wherein the step S3 includes the steps of:
s31, if the local control end user controls the mouse, directly sending the mouse event to the remote controlled end through UDP according to the format of the data structure;
s32, if the local control end user operates the touch pad and the touch screen, obtaining absolute position information of the mouse, converting the absolute position information into relative coordinates through a normalization algorithm, and sending the relative coordinates to the remote controlled end through UDP according to the format of the data structure;
s33, the local control end gradually moves the coordinates from the starting point to the end point according to the obtained starting point and end point coordinates of the touch pad and the touch screen and the resolution of the screen, and converts the absolute coordinates into relative coordinates;
the normalization algorithm is to obtain the resolutions of the control end and the remote controlled end, and then convert the mouse coordinate of the local control end into the mouse coordinate of the remote controlled end, as shown in fig. 2.
S4, switching between the control of the local control end and the control of the remote controlled end on the mouse and the keyboard is realized through the sent command; the step S4 includes the steps of:
s41, if the local control end controls the remote controlled end, sending a command ctrl + alt + t to process mouse and keyboard events;
and S42, if the local control end stops controlling the remote controlled end, sending a ctrl + alt + q command to disconnect from the remote controlled end.
S5, the remote controlled end registers a character device virtual Mouse keyboard event, as shown in figure 3, a Linux Mouse Driver and a character device Driver are written to register the character device Driver to establish a virtual Mouse event, a Linux Kbd Driver and a character device Driver are written to register the character device Driver to establish a virtual kbdevent keyboard event, and a write function is written to write an analyzed message into the virtual Mouse and keyboard event;
the method comprises the steps of establishing a virtual mouse event and a keyboard event, and interacting with a Write function and a Read function through an ioctl function. The ioctl function is a function that manages an I/O channel of a device in a device driver.
And S6, the remote controlled end receives and analyzes the message sent from the local control end, and writes the message into the virtual mouse and keyboard event of the remote controlled end to realize remote control. The step S6 includes the following steps:
s61, the remote controlled end receives the stop control command, the network receiving process continues to receive the message, but the message information is not written into the mousevent and kbdevent events;
and S62, the remote controlled end receiving process receives the control command, analyzes the received message, writes the analyzed message into a mousevent event and a kbdevent event, and continues remote control.
If the remote controlled end consists of a plurality of host computers and a plurality of display screens, if the local control end needs to control any large screen information, the local control end can control any display screen interface information by specifying the display screen serial number ID.
